Common Problems: VOLVO XC40
Known issues reported by owners and MOT testers.
- Infotainment Freezing and Software Glitches(Moderate)
Earlier cars with Sensus and 2022+ models with Google-based Android Automotive can suffer from screen freezes, blackouts, or lost GPS/connectivity.
- 12V Battery Drain and Start-Stop Faults(Moderate)
Battery-management and software issues can flatten the auxiliary or main 12V battery, causing stop-start failure and low-voltage warnings.
- Powered Tailgate Strut and Rear-End Hardware Issues(Moderate)
The power tailgate on earlier XC40s can corrode, strain or stop closing properly, especially on cars living outdoors through salted winters.
